Cheryl Williams, a 46-year-old convicted felon who spent nine years in prison on a drug trafficking conviction, is now charged with second-degree murder in the shooting death of Polk County Sheriff’s Deputy Blane Lane, 21.

Polk County Sheriff’s Deputy, 21, Killed Serving a Warrant
Just before 2:30 a.m. Tuesday morning, four Polk County Sheriff‘s deputies drove up to a weather-beaten mobile home off Foxtown South Road in a rural area west of Polk City with an arrest warrant for 46-year-old Cheryl Williams for failure to appear on felony charges of possession of methamphetamine.

FBI Doubles Reward for Lakeland Man Wanted in Attack on Officers During Capitol Riot
The FBI has doubled the award for information leading to the arrest of Jonathan Pollock, 23, of Lakeland, who is wanted in connection with the assault of police officers with a weapon during rioting at the U.S. Capitol on Jan. 6, 2021. The reward is now $30,000. | WFTV report
SUV Driver Arrested in Fatal Hit & Run Involving a Motorcyclist
A 39-year-old man was arrested after he left and then returned to the scene of a collision that resulted in the death of a 46-year-old motorcyclist on South Florida Avenue, according to the Lakeland Police Department.

Bryan Riley Plans Insanity Defense in Deaths of North Lakeland Family
Lawyers for quadruple murder defendant Bryan James Riley intend to argue that he was insane when he killed four people, including a 3-month-old infant, during a home-invasion attack in north Lakeland last September.
Judd on Armed Man Who Had Threatened to Kill Wife, Deputies: ‘We Shot Him. A Lot’
A man who had been firing a gun and threatened to kill his wife was shot and killed by Polk County deputies Friday evening at the Ten Rocks Mobile Home Park on North Combee Road, Sheriff Grady Judd said.

Dozens Wrote Letters Urging Leniency for Former Commissioner Dunn
Forty-nine people including elected officials and a retired FBI special agent submitted letters in support of former Lakeland City Commissioner Michael Dunn, hoping to convince Judge Donald Jacobsen to be lenient while deciding Dunn’s fate.
